SEVEN TIME Formula 1 world champion Lewis Hamilton is revved up and keen to find...

Trips to Namibia, Kenya, Tanzania, and Rwanda left him “fully transformed” as he documented his journey through social mediaSEVEN TIME Formula 1 world champion Lewis Hamilton is revved up and keen to find his family’s roots.In a recent interview with Sky Sports, the Great Briton admitted that it was time to re-find his roots and consequentially re-find ‘peace.’

“It’s not until I’ve got into my 30s that I’ve wanted to go down this road of discovery, to try to understand, where did we get the Hamilton name? Where were we originally from? Where did the slaves come over on the ships from to the Caribbean? Hamilton has had had to redefine himself throughout his career to battle discrimination, a factor that enticed him to return to Africa and learn more about his true self on a journey of self discovery and growth.The aforementioned trip to Africa was not a spur of the moment decision, but a well thought-out trip for Hamilton. “I made the decision in January that I was going to take on that discovery.

But this would not stop him from taking advantage of the trip, which ended up being “One of, if not the most, special experience” for him.
